In the UK there were an estimated 3,000 breeding pairs of Collared Doves in 1964. How many breeding pairs were recorded in 2008?
a) 300
b) 30,000
c) 300,000
In the USA less than fifty escaped from captivity in the Bahamas in 1974. They can now be found in virtually every U.S. State as well as Mexico. Such is the phenomenal spread and increase in the population of the Collared Dove that the answer is c) 300,000 breeding pairs were recorded in the UK in 2008, a one hundred fold increase.
